Subject: [PATCH 10/25] x86/pci: add cap_resource
Date: Tue, 22 Dec 2009 15:40:48 -0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1261525263-13763-11-git-send-email-yinghai@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1261525263-13763-1-git-send-email-yinghai@kernel.org>

prepare for 32bit pci root bus

-v2: hpa said we should compare with (resource_size_t)~0

Signed-off-by: Yinghai Lu <yinghai@kernel.org>
---
 arch/x86/pci/amd_bus.c   |    8 +++++---
 arch/x86/pci/bus_numa.c  |    3 +++
 arch/x86/pci/intel_bus.c |    5 ++++-
 include/linux/range.h    |    8 ++++++++
 4 files changed, 20 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/x86/pci/amd_bus.c b/arch/x86/pci/amd_bus.c
index e8bb553..9bcb6fe 100644
--- a/arch/x86/pci/amd_bus.c
+++ b/arch/x86/pci/amd_bus.c
@@ -201,7 +201,7 @@ static int __init early_fill_mp_bus_info(void)
 
 	memset(range, 0, sizeof(range));
 	/* 0xfd00000000-0xffffffffff for HT */
-	range[0].end = (0xfdULL<<32) - 1;
+	range[0].end = cap_resource((0xfdULL<<32) - 1);
 
 	/* need to take out [0, TOM) for RAM*/
 	address = MSR_K8_TOP_MEM1;
@@ -286,7 +286,8 @@ static int __init early_fill_mp_bus_info(void)
 			}
 		}
 
-		update_res(info, start, end, IORESOURCE_MEM, 1);
+		update_res(info, cap_resource(start), cap_resource(end),
+				 IORESOURCE_MEM, 1);
 		subtract_range(range, RANGE_NUM, start, end);
 		printk(KERN_CONT "\n");
 	}
@@ -321,7 +322,8 @@ static int __init early_fill_mp_bus_info(void)
 			if (!range[i].end)
 				continue;
 
-			update_res(info, range[i].start, range[i].end,
+			update_res(info, cap_resource(range[i].start),
+				   cap_resource(range[i].end),
 				   IORESOURCE_MEM, 1);
 		}
 	}
diff --git a/arch/x86/pci/bus_numa.c b/arch/x86/pci/bus_numa.c
index 7ef0970..411955f 100644
--- a/arch/x86/pci/bus_numa.c
+++ b/arch/x86/pci/bus_numa.c
@@ -55,6 +55,9 @@ void __init update_res(struct pci_root_info *info, resource_size_t start,
 	if (start > end)
 		return;
 
+	if (start == (resource_size_t)~0)
+		return;
+
 	if (!merge)
 		goto addit;
 
diff --git a/arch/x86/pci/intel_bus.c b/arch/x86/pci/intel_bus.c
index baf283a..1f15df9 100644
--- a/arch/x86/pci/intel_bus.c
+++ b/arch/x86/pci/intel_bus.c
@@ -6,6 +6,8 @@
 #include <linux/dmi.h>
 #include <linux/pci.h>
 #include <linux/init.h>
+#include <linux/range.h>
+
 #include <asm/pci_x86.h>
 
 #include "bus_numa.h"
@@ -85,7 +87,8 @@ static void __devinit pci_root_bus_res(struct pci_dev *dev)
 	mmioh_base |= ((u64)(dword & 0x7ffff)) << 32;
 	pci_read_config_dword(dev, IOH_LMMIOH_LIMITU, &dword);
 	mmioh_end |= ((u64)(dword & 0x7ffff)) << 32;
-	update_res(info, mmioh_base, mmioh_end, IORESOURCE_MEM, 0);
+	update_res(info, cap_resource(mmioh_base), cap_resource(mmioh_end),
+			 IORESOURCE_MEM, 0);
 
 	print_ioh_resources(info);
 }
diff --git a/include/linux/range.h b/include/linux/range.h
index 0789f14..17a23d2 100644
--- a/include/linux/range.h
+++ b/include/linux/range.h
@@ -19,4 +19,12 @@ int clean_sort_range(struct range *range, int az);
 
 void sort_range(struct range *range, int nr_range);
 
+
+static inline resource_size_t cap_resource(u64 val)
+{
+	if (val > (resource_size_t)~0)
+		return (resource_size_t)~0;
+	else
+		return val;
+}
 #endif
